Rules for tax-free Medicare spending
When it comes to Medicare expenses, there are specific rules and guidelines that govern how you can use your HSA funds. It's essential to understand the following key points:
- You can use your HSA money tax-free to pay for Medicare premiums (Part A, B, C, and D).
- You can also use your HSA funds tax-free to cover Medicare deductibles, copayments, and coinsurance.
HSA contributions and post-enrollment use
It's important to note that once you enroll in Medicare, you can no longer contribute to your HSA. However, you can continue to use the existing funds in your HSA to pay for qualified medical expenses, including those related to Medicare.
